Aracılığıyla paylaş


Excel hedef

Excel hedef çalışma sayfasına veri yükler veya aralıklar içinde Microsoft Excel çalışma kitapları.

Excel hedef modları verileri yüklemek için üç farklı veri erişim sağlar:

  • Tablo veya görünüm.

  • Bir tablo veya görünüm bir değişken belirtilmiş.

  • Bir sql deyim sonuçlar.Sorgu Parametreli Sorgu olabilir.

Önemli notÖnemli

Excel'de, çalışma sayfası veya aralık tablo ya da Görünüm aynıdır.Excel kaynak ve hedef Düzenleyicisi içinde kullanılabilir tabloların listesi (Sayfa1$ gibi bir çalışma sayfası adı eklenen $ işareti tarafından tanımlanan) yalnızca varolan çalışma sayfalarını görüntüleme ve adlandırılmış aralıkları (yokluğunda MyRange gibi $ işareti tarafından tanımlanan).

Excel hedef bir verilere bağlanmak için bir Excel Bağlantı Yöneticisi kullanır kaynak, ve Bağlantı Yöneticisi'ni kullanmak için çalışma kitabı dosyasını belirtir.Daha fazla bilgi için bkz: Excel Bağlantı Yöneticisi.

Excel hedef normal bir giriş ve çıkış bir hata vardır.

Kullanımı hakkında önemli noktalar

Excel Bağlantı Yöneticisi'nin kullandığı Microsoft için Jet 4.0 ole db Sağlayıcısı ve destekleyici Excel ISAM (dizili sıralı erişim yöntemi) sürücüsünü bağlanmak ve okuma ve yazma verileri Excel veri kaynakları.

Var olan birçok Microsoft Bilgi Bankası makaleleri bu sağlayıcı ve sürücü davranışı belge ve bu makaleler için belirli olmasa da Integration Services veya öncülü Data Transformation Services isteyebilirsiniz beklenmeyen sonuçlar açabilir belirli davranışları hakkında bilmenizExcel sürücüsü davranışını ve kullanımı hakkında genel bilgi için bkz: nasıl yapılır: ADO'yu Visual Basic'de veya VBA'da Excel verileriyle kullanma.

Excel sürücüsü ile gelen Jet sağlayıcı aşağıdaki davranışları çok beklenmeyen yol açabilecek sonuçlar verileri bir Excel hedef için kaydederken.

  • Metin verilerini kaydetme.Excel sürücüsü için bir Excel hedef veri değerleri metin kaydettiğinde, sürücü metni her önündeki hücre ile kaydedilen değerler metin değerleri olarak yorumlanacaktır emin olmak için tek tırnak (').Varsa veya okunan diğer uygulamalar veya kaydedilen veri işlem, özel işlem önündeki her metin değeri tek tırnak karakteri eklemeniz gerekebilir.

  • not (ntext) da kaydederekta.Dizelerini 255 karakterden daha uzun bir Excel sütun için başarılı bir şekilde kaydedebilmek için önce sürücü hedef sütunun veri türünü tanımaz Not ve dize.Hedef tablo sürücü tarafından örneklenen ilk birkaç satırına en az bir örneğini memo sütunundaki 255 karakterden uzun bir değer içermesi gerekir zaten, veri satırları içerir.Hedef Tablo paket tasarım sırasında veya çalışma oluşturduysanız, saat, sonra da veri türü olarak longtext (veya onun eşanlamlı biri) create table deyimni kullanmanız gerekir memo sütunundaki.

  • Veri türleri.Excel sürücüsü yalnızca sınırlı tanıdığı küme veri türü.For example, all numeric columns are interpreted as doubles (DT_R8), and all string columns (other than memo columns) are interpreted as 255-character Unicode strings (DT_WSTR).Integration Services maps the Excel data types as follows:

    • Sayısal çift duyarlıklı kayan nokta (DT_R8)

    • Para birimi para birimi (dt_cy)

    • Boolean Boole (dt_bool)

    • Tarih/saat datetime (dt_date)

    • Dize Unicode dize, uzunluk 255 (dt_wstr)

    • Not Unicode metin akışı (dt_ntext)

  • Data type and length conversions.Integration Services does not implicitly convert data types.Sonuç olarak, türetilmiş sütun veya veri dönüşümü dönüşümleri-Excel hedef yüklemeden önce açıkça Excel verilerini dönüştürmek için ya da bir Excel hedef yüklemeden önce olmayan Excel verilerini dönüştürmek için kullanmanız gerekebilir.Bu durum, Al ve yapılandırır, gerekli Dönüşümleri Ver Sihirbazı'nı kullanarak başlangıç paket oluşturmak yararlı olabilir.Gerekli dönüşümleri bazı örnekler şunlardır:

    • Unicode Excel dize sütunlar ve belirli kod sayfaları ile Unicode olmayan dize sütunlar arasında dönüştürme.

    • 255 Karakter Excel dize sütunlar ve farklı uzunlukta dize sütunlar arasında dönüştürme.

    • Çift duyarlıklı Excel sayısal sütunlar ve diğer türleri sayısal sütunlar arasında dönüştürme.

Excel hedef yapılandırma

Yapabilirsiniz küme Özellikler'inde SSIS Tasarımcısı veya programlı olarak.

Yapabilirsiniz özellikleri hakkında daha fazla bilgi için küme , Excel hedef Düzenleyicisi iletişim kutusunda, aşağıdaki konulardan birini tıklatın:

The Advanced Editor dialog box reflects all the properties that can be set programmatically.Yapabilirsiniz özellikleri hakkında daha fazla bilgi için küme , Gelişmiş Düzenleyici iletişim kutusunda veya programlı olarak aşağıdaki konulardan birini tıklatın:

Özellikleri küme hakkında daha fazla bilgi için bkz: Nasıl yapılır: Bir veri akışı bileşen özelliklerini ayarlama.

Excel dosya grubu döngü hakkında daha fazla bilgi için bkz: Nasıl yapılır: Döngü Excel dosyaları ve Foreach döngü kabı kullanarak tablolar.

Integration Services simgesi (küçük)Integration Services ile güncel kalın

En son karşıdan yüklemeler, makaleler, örnekler ve seçilen topluluk çözümleri yanı sıra Microsoft videolar için ziyaret Integration Services sayfa msdn veya TechNet:

Bu güncelleştirmelerle ilgili otomatik bildirim almak için, sayfadaki RSS akışlarına abone olun.